Drain pipe repair services focus on fixing issues with the pipes responsible for directing wastewater away from a property. These services typically involve inspecting, cleaning, and replacing damaged or corroded sections of drain pipes to ensure proper flow and prevent leaks. Skilled contractors use specialized tools and techniques to identify problems such as blockages, cracks, or collapses, restoring the drain system’s functionality and helping to avoid more serious plumbing issues down the line.
Problems that lead to drain pipe repairs often include persistent clogs, slow draining sinks or tubs, foul odors, or water pooling around the foundation. Over time, pipes can develop cracks or holes due to age, shifting soil, or root intrusion, which can cause leaks and water damage. Routine inspections and timely repairs can prevent these issues from escalating into costly repairs or property damage, making drain pipe repair an important part of maintaining a healthy plumbing system.

The overview below groups typical Drain Pipe Repair projects into broad ranges so you can see how smaller, mid-sized, and larger jobs often compare in your area.
In many markets, a large share of routine jobs stays in the lower and middle ranges, while only a smaller percentage of projects moves into the highest bands when the work is more complex or site conditions are harder than average.
Smaller Repairs - typical costs for minor drain pipe repairs range from $250 to $600. Many routine fixes, such as sealing leaks or replacing small sections, fall within this range. Larger or more complex repairs can exceed this, but they are less common.
Moderate Repairs - projects involving partial pipe replacements or repairs usually cost between $600 and $1,500. These jobs are common and often involve replacing a segment of pipe or fixing multiple leaks.
Full Replacement - replacing an entire drain pipe system can range from $2,000 to $5,000 or more, depending on the property size and pipe material. Many full replacements stay within this range, although larger or more intricate installations can push higher.
Large or Complex Projects - extensive drain pipe repairs or replacements, especially in commercial properties, can reach $5,000+ or more. Such projects are less frequent but typically involve significant labor and material costs.
Actual totals will depend on details like access to the work area, the scope of the project, and the materials selected, so use these as general starting points rather than exact figures.

What causes drain pipe damage? Drain pipes can be damaged by factors such as age, corrosion, blockages, or shifting soil, which may lead to leaks or clogs.
How do professionals repair broken or cracked drain pipes? Local contractors may use methods like pipe lining, patching, or replacing damaged sections to restore proper function.
Can drain pipe repairs prevent future issues? Yes, proper repairs can help prevent leaks, backups, and further deterioration of the plumbing system.
What signs indicate a need for drain pipe repair? Signs include persistent clogs, foul odors, water backups, or visible cracks and leaks around the pipes.
